Ecuador takes lead against Chile after Tiane Endler error

Ecuador scored the opening goal against Chile in the 37th minute at Estadio Nacional in the CONMEBOL Women's Nations League. Justine Cuadra's goal came from an error by goalkeeper Tiane Endler.

The match between Chile's women's team and Ecuador was part of the eighth round of the tournament. Chile aimed to secure a spot in the repechage for the 2027 World Cup in Brazil. At the 37-minute mark Tiane Endler moved forward with the ball and passed to Nayadet López Opazo. Justine Cuadra intercepted and scored for the 1-0 lead. At the end of the first half the score stood at Chile 0-1 Ecuador. The team coached by Luis Mena needs the win to reach 13 points.
